Subject: ChipGate cut-over — done

Hey Moira,

Quick recap for your review: we finished the cut-over of the ChipGate timing-chip readers to the new ingest cluster last night, ahead of the Lakerun Marathon. Old readers are decommissioned, and all mats now report over the mutual-TLS channel. Replay protection is on, and we rotated the signing material during the switch. Nothing weird in the logs so far. For your audit notes, the post-cut-over configuration currently in effect is listed below.

settings of bawif-fawif:
ralix:
  log_level: warn
  metrics_host: metrics.ralix.tolvaqsys.internal
  pool_size: 32

11:05 — So, the Gravelpond repo had no SQL linting at all, which is how the unparameterized query slipped in. Dana's team wired up the new Quenchline ruleset, blocking string-built statements at commit time. Backfill scan of old migrations found two more offenders, both patched. Verification build token follows.

trace token, fafog-kageg: htk4_98e6

## Who to ping about GiftNote

Welcome aboard! GiftNote is our donation-receipt mailer for the Larchfield Fund. Template tweaks go to the comms folks; delivery failures and bounce weirdness go to the platform crew. Don't push template changes on Fridays — receipts batch over the weekend. For anything GiftNote-related, start with the address below.

billing contact of kaweg-tajeg = drudor.lamion.oliath@torvalabs.test

## Approvals: Websocket Reconnect Fix

This page tracks sign-off for the patch addressing the reconnect storm in the Pondbridge gateway, where dropped websocket sessions retried without backoff and overwhelmed the edge nodes. The fix adds jittered exponential backoff and caps concurrent reconnect attempts per client. QA has verified behavior under simulated network flaps, and load testing passed on staging. Before we schedule the rollout, we need one final approval per our change policy. The approver responsible for this change is named below.

account owner for tawip-kahop: Oliok Jorix Ulaath Quenok